A 39-year-old member asked:
do you know if auro ear drops for pain and ciprodex ear drops can be used together?
1 doctor answer • 1 doctor weighed in

Dr. Ronald Ward answered
Specializes in ENT and Head and Neck Surgery
Ear drops: Would not use together. Will reduce efficacy of ciprodex. Take some ibuprofen and apply warm compress to ear. Soft diet to decrease TMJ pressure on ear canal.

A 44-year-old member asked:
Can auro ear drops for pain and ciprodex ear drops be used together?
1 doctor answer • 1 doctor weighed in

Dr. Jonathan Owens answered
ENT and Head and Neck Surgery 34 years experience
Yes: yes, they can. I would urge you to exercise caution with the Auralgan (benzocaine and antipyrine) drops. If a tube is in the ear or the eardrum is perforated, those drops are not advisable as they could cause hearing loss. If neither of those conditions are present, then proceed.
